Output 990ceeb797a974da4257a3f7282ce611585ffa8953b63ef83f3164ab1150cc36:19

value
142593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cca448bb8b8e39f72fa9fe08239b5d4e949b6a18 OP_EQUAL
address
3LM4aLX7PYD28uKzwXKwL7pM97JYYhRvCk
transaction
990ceeb797a974da4257a3f7282ce611585ffa8953b63ef83f3164ab1150cc36
confirmations
276504
spent
true